Fidelrevenue.org is a fraudulent investment platform. The website, recently registered just 80 days ago, lacks a customer service phone number. It promises substantial returns, but once you invest, the operators vanish with your funds. The business location listed on the site is fabricated, and it’s run by individuals or a company from overseas.

Investment scams lure individuals with promises of high returns, but once money is invested, the perpetrators disappear, leaving victims with nothing.

An investment scam involves fraudsters who promise high returns with little risk. These scammers often claim they have exclusive information or a unique opportunity that guarantees profit. They may present fake credentials or endorsements to appear credible. Scammers use high-pressure tactics to rush decisions. They create a sense of urgency, saying the offer is limited or others are eager to invest. This pressure makes people act without thinking thoroughly. They often promise consistent returns, regardless of market conditions. It's a red flag if the investment seems too good to be true. Scammers might use complex jargon to confuse potential investors, making the scheme seem legitimate. Fraudsters sometimes create fake websites or documents to support their claims. They manipulate emotions, building trust through personal connections or testimonials.
